Video Production Specialist II (Finance)



Department: Technology Learning Services Salary: $48,000 - $51,000
Description:
Job Summary

The Video Production Specialist II produces live broadcasts and supports the video production needs of faculty, staff and related University community events. This position will serve as the lead on productions in the evening, night and weekend events as needed.

Duties

  • Operates the video production facility and supports university live webinars and events
  • Performs and leads AV equipment set-up and provides operational training for equipment requests
  • Records events using digital and/or basic video/audio principles
  • Films and directs on location for internal and external productions
  • Manages live meetings and productions by operating and controlling multiple cameras and remote videoconferencing sites
  • Captures and masters professional quality videos for distribution to internal and external customers and provides other critical support functions for live meetings and events
  • Produces multimedia aide for use in meetings, training sessions, and/or live broadcast events
  • Performs routine equipment maintenance checks/troubleshooting and ensures that repairs are completed in a timely manner
  • Designs and creates custom graphics for use in video production, digital animation, digital presentations, and other digital communications
  • Designs and creates digital media utilizing a combination of original artwork, stock images, and off-the-shelf graphics
  • This position serves as a team lead on productions scheduled during nights and weekends as needed
